Output 663c660b53a8638558899d52550c1ffc601040f2e72755bed7b7e9906b50827c:0

value
2327958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9fe68ce21779c61b8db6c2df71fd133b40f724c OP_EQUAL
address
3L74WmytFdg9FcZnBjsCdN74xQgJLG1fke
transaction
663c660b53a8638558899d52550c1ffc601040f2e72755bed7b7e9906b50827c
spent
true